    What you'll be doing:

    This is a brand new role, created specifically to lead the Resource Planning team, to help ensure that we know our internal and external customer demand for local, regional and national accounts.

    You and your team will deliver accurate forecasts and proactively plan resourcing needs for customer contacts related to - service performance, invoicing, customer feedback, contract mobilisation and general enquiry contacts via phone, email, livechat, webform and other off phone channels.

    In this role you will directly be responsible for creating and delivering a multi-site contact centre workforce strategy, forecasting for future customer demand using previous contact trends and working with stakeholders across the commercial waste collection business to gain an understanding of new business and changes to the operation or legislation that may change customer contact demands.

    And by producing regular reports on resource utilisation and KPI performance, you will help manage the requirements within budget or assist with business cases where resource needs to increase to meet service level.
